What is the Compliance Check/Alcohol Purchase Survey Database?
The Compliance Check/Alcohol Purchase Survey Database is a tool that law enforcement agencies and community groups can use to track illegal sales to minors. This database is designed so that individuals from local enforcement agencies and community groups may enter their data from either compliance checks or alcohol purchase surveys directly into the system. The database is designed with the intention that the local official or individual most familiar with the local data will be able to enter the data into the system easily.
These operations involve sending minors or young-looking adults into stores to purchase alcohol. In this way, law enforcement agencies and community members can find out who is selling alcoholic beverages to our children. The OJJDP Guide to Conducting Alcohol Purchase Surveys includes in Appendix 3 (page 62) a Data Collection Form for completion following alcohol purchase attempts by a minor or youthful-looking adult during alcohol sales compliance operations. This form collects information and is designed to permit immediate opportunities for data analysis, interpretation, and reporting. The database is especially helpful for analysis of survey and enforcement findings, and for comparison of findings over time.
Why use Compliance Checks and/or Alcohol Purchase Surveys?
Illegal sales to minors can be prevented, but most communities need valid information in order to do the most effective job of prevention. Compliance Checks/Alcohol purchase survey operations can provide this information. They also:
- Tell us who is selling to minors and how often
- Raise community awareness and build support for reducing sales to minors
- Inform merchants that they are being monitored by the community
- Aid law enforcement
- Help monitor the impact of prevention strategies
